Vineyard Site
The hand-picked grapes for this Blaufränkisch ripened in average 30-year-old vineyards (currently in conversion to biodynamic viticulture) in the Joiser Riede Altenberg on the unique limestone soil on the slopes of the Leithagebirge. This gives this wine its special elegance, finesse and minerality.

Vintage description
2016 started out difficult with frost that lead to a substantial loss in yield. This was followed by a wet and cold summer with perpetual threats of fungal infections. On the bright side the water supply for the vines was ideal for the subsequent almost too hot September. All’s well that ends well.

Winery
As residents of Burgenland in the far east of Austria and as winemakers in Gols, we find ourselves in a multiply fortunate position. Because the Pannonian climate at Lake Neusiedl is not only beneficial and wonderful to live in, but also perfectly predestined for viticulture. The same applies to the diverse soils. This obliges us to produce wines of the highest quality. Starting with the 2013 vintage, all of our winery wines will be organic or biodynamic. In addition, Gols, where our family has been producing wine since 1684, is also a little away from the hustle and bustle of the city.
